Miss USA Out Of Rehab, Resuming Press Duties

LOS ANGELES (January 23, 2007) — Miss USA Tara Conner is out of rehab Access Hollywood has learned.

Sources tell Access, the pageant queen checked out of Pennsylvania based Caron Foundation rehabilitation facility last Friday and headed back to her Trump Place apartment, in New York City.

The 21-year-old spent a month at the facility after allegations surfaced of reported drinking and drug use, almost costing her the crown. Miss Universe Organization owner Donald Trump gave Conner another chance, after she agreed to enter rehab and undergo drug testing in December.

Now that she’s out, insiders tell Access she’ll resume public appearances, beginning with a People magazine interview later this week, before hitting the talk show circuit.The NY Daily News reported that Conner was mulling a welcome-home party at Stereo, scene of some of the behavior that had initially been questioned. The Miss USA pageant vehemently denied the report.

“Tara Conner will not be at Stereo for a coming-out party – or any party at Stereo, for that matter,” said pageant spokeswoman Lark-Marie Anton.
